Rod Hill, C.P.A.
Chief
Financial Officer
Roderick D. Hill, CPA is CenterPoint’s Chief Financial Officer. He has
extensive for-profit and nonprofit accounting and tax experience. After
three years as a member of a medium sized Chicago CPA firm, Rod moved
into private industry and filled increasingly more responsible positions
including Controllership, Operations Management, Corporate Treasurer and
Corporate Internal Audit Management of a public company. Rod went into
private practice as a Certified Public Accountant in 1988 specializing
in Corporate Accounting and Taxation and Individual Estate Tax Planning.
Rod’s professional introduction to the nonprofit sector began as a
trustee of a charitable remainder trust, a position he retained for a
number of years. Rod still maintains a diverse accounting and tax
practice along with his CFO responsibilities at CenterPoint. He
specifically enjoys helping clients with estate planning, estate tax
return filings, tax minimization strategies and family wealth transfer
planning.
Rod is a Certified Public Accountant and holds a BS Degree in
Accountancy from Northern Illinois University. He still plays a mean
guitar, though not quite as fast as he once did – maybe because his hair
is much shorter now.
